In the past, we have not supported MySQL Alter Procedure because MySQL does not support Atomic DDL for altering procedures. An atomic DDL requires a ALTER PROCEDURE DDL or DDL in transactions, and MySQL doesn't support either. We should reinvestigate this now to see if we can make Alter Procedure editable.

Thank you for the investigation Shubham. Unfortunately the create or replace really, under the covers, does a drop/create for MariaDB. I don't want to implement the drop/create in ADS because it is dangerous.
Let's not do anything further on this issue for ADS v22.1.
